#d14584 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d14584 is composed of 82% red, 27.1% green and 51.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 67% magenta, 36.8%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 333 degrees, a saturation of 60.3% and a lightness of 54.5%. #d14584 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8aff with #a30009.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.

● #d14584 color description : Moderate pink.
#d14584 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d14584 has RGB values of R:209, G:69, B:132 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.67, Y:0.37,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13714820.

Shades and Tints of #d14584
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030102 is the darkest color, while #fcf2f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d14584
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#93838a is the less saturated color, while #fe1880 is the most saturated one.
